After the Red Wings’ loss to the Florida Panthers on Thursday night, I Tweeted out the following stat:
With last night’s loss, the Red Wings are now 281-265-46 all-time in games played in arenas with Center/Centre in the name.
— DetroitHockey.Net (@detroithockey96) February 5, 2016
This led to a brief discussion of whether the Red Wings’ new arena should be an Arena or a Center or a Garden (or an Emporium, for those with more eclectic tastes).
The newest feature to DetroitHockey.Net is the ability to search by arena name in the Searchable Schedule & Score Archive. So I used it to compile the Red Wings’ record by arena name type.
With an extremely small sample size, the Wings’ have fared best in venues with the name “Field,” as they’re 1-0 at Wrigley Field.
With four total games played, Detroit is 3-1 in Halls, namely one season visiting the Tampa Bay Lightning at Expo Hall
Up next is Palace, with the Red Wings 6-2-2 in games played against the San Jose Sharks at Daly City’s Cow Palace and the Lightning when their current arena was known as the Ice Palace.
In 56 games in arenas with “Place” in the name (GM Place, Rexall Place, and Scotiabank Place) – possibly the first result with any kind of statistical reliability – the Red Wings are 32-20-4, for a .607 winning percentage. So Sponsor Place at District Detroit might make some sense.
The Duck-centric “Pond” used by the Arrowhead Pond of Anaheim carries with it at 16-10-4 record but isn’t really an option for the Red Wings.
Olympia Stadium and the Red Wings’ 1950s dynasty contributed to Detroit’s 1107-699-316 record in Stadiums, with Chicago Stadium and the 2014 Winter Classic at Michigan Stadium filling out the rest.
Meanwhile the Red Wings’ other homes of Joe Louis Arena and Border Cities Arena are part of a set where they have a combined 1119-796-175.
The last set with a winning record would be the aforementioned Center/Centre at 281-265-46.
Domes (Saddledome, Checkerdome, Thunderdome), Coliseums (including Colisee de Quebec), Garden/Gardens, Forums and Auditoriums are all places where the Red Wings have a sub-.500 record.
Rounding things out, the Red Wings are winless in Corrals (Stampede Corral in Calgary) and Globes (Ericsson Globe in Stockholm).
The full set of numbers are as follows:
Arena Type | W | L | T | Pct |
---|---|---|---|---|
Field | 1 | 0 | 0 | 1.000 |
Hall | 3 | 1 | 0 | .750 |
Palace | 6 | 2 | 2 | .700 |
Place | 32 | 20 | 4 | .607 |
Pond | 16 | 10 | 4 | .600 |
Stadium | 1107 | 699 | 316 | .596 |
Arena | 1119 | 796 | 175 | .577 |
Cent(er/re) | 286 | 267 | 46 | .516 |
Dome | 34 | 42 | 4 | .450 |
Colise(e/um) | 72 | 102 | 25 | .425 |
Garden(s) | 347 | 513 | 158 | .418 |
Forum | 107 | 246 | 62 | .333 |
Spectrum | 12 | 30 | 10 | .327 |
Auditorium | 12 | 41 | 8 | .262 |
Corral | 0 | 3 | 2 | .200 |
Globe | 0 | 2 | 0 | .000 |
